Small Businesses, Big Wins
Across sectors, small and midsize businesses are using Artificial Intelligence to reduce costs, streamline operations, and elevate customer experience with measurable results and minimal overhead.
Beauty brands
Beauty brands are using AI-powered recommendation engines to reduce return rates by up to 22%, while increasing repeat purchases by 30% through personalized shopping experiences.
Restaurants and cafés
Restaurants and cafés are leveraging AI for demand forecasting and scheduling—cutting food waste by 28% and saving thousands annually through optimized staffing and inventory.
Hospitality providers
Hospitality providers are deploying AI chat assistants to manage guest communication—reducing response times from over an hour to just minutes and improving customer satisfaction scores by 18%.
Content creators and solopreneurs
Content creators and solopreneurs are using generative AI to script, edit, and caption content—cutting production time by 50% and doubling their content output without added cost.
